I have seen multiple middle school games this Fall in the Hampton Roads region. Some talented teams to include Blair, Churchland, Oscar Smith, and the 757 Colts. Lots of depth on all of these teams. Below are a list of prospects, who I believe have the ability, genetics, habits, and character to become FBS prospects. These kids are not done growing, and are already flashing college attributes in eighth grade. With consistency in the weight room, good coaching, and training, these kids can be high level prospects in three years.
